  • Abstract
    In this paper we present the motivation, design, development, and initial evaluation of a time awareness technology for meetings. As part of improving meetings effectiveness using technology, we focus on the meeting time management, and the method relies on presenting real-time notifications of the progression of the meeting phases to the participants. We then evaluate the utility of the technology, and its impact on the people and their behavior in the meeting, concluding that such a support system brings added value to the meeting outcome in a number of ways.
